using the built-in BATTERY tester

OVERVIEW

This battery charger has a built-in battery tester that displays either an accurate bat- tery voltage or an estimate of the battery’s relative charge based on the battery volt- age and the Battery Council International scale.

TESTER WITHOUT TIME LIMIT

If either the DIGITAL Display or Bat- tery Type button is pressed within the first 15 minutes after the PSC-12500A is powered up, it will remain a tester (not a charger) indefinitely, unless a charge rate is selected.

TESTING AFTER CHARGING

After the PSC-12500A has been changed from tester to charger (by selecting a charge rate), it remains a charger. To change the PSC-12500A back to a tester, press the CHARGE START button until all charge rate LEDs are off.

TESTER AND CHARGER

When first turned on, the PSC-12500A

operates only as a tester, not as a charger. To continue to use it as only a tester, avoid pressing the charge start button. Se- lecting a charge rate activates the battery charger and deactivates the tester. Press- ing the CHARGE start button when the engine start LED is lit (except during the 180 second cool down) will shut off the charger and activate the tester.

POWER-UP IDLE TIME LIMIT

If no button is pressed within 15 minutes

after the PSC-12500A is first powered up,

it will automatically switch from tester to charger, if a battery is connected. In that case, the charger will be set for the small battery charge rate and 12V regular battery type.

TESTER STATUS LEDs

When the PSC-12500A is operating as a battery tester, the status LEDs light under the following conditions:

The CHARGED (green) LED will light if a charged battery is tested.

The CHARGING (yellow) LED does not light in the battery test mode.

TheconnectedLEDlightsifaproperly connected battery is detected.

When the tester digital display is set to voltage, the CHARGED and CHARG- ING LEDs won't light (it could be testing a battery or an alternator).

INITIAL PERCENT CALCULATION When a battery % is calculated for the first time after connecting a battery, the digital display will show three dashes (“---”) for a period as long as several seconds while the tester analyzes the battery.

NOTES FOR TESTING BATTERY %

A recently charged battery could have a temporarily high voltage due to what is known as “surface charge”. The voltage of such a battery will gradually drop during the period immediately after the charging system is disengaged. Consequently, the tester could display inconsistent values
